Men are too scared to flirt in case they are branded sex pests says Parkinson
Parkinson said he feels men have grown increasingly afraid of interacting with women in recent years after the wave of sexual harassment claims against some of Hollywood’s elite.
He added: “You feel yourself, all men do, being under threat for the merest indication they might be flirting with someone.”
He enjoyed flirtatious moments with some of Hollywood’s most famous actresses on his long-running talk show, including screen queens Lauren Bacall and Shirley MacLaine.
Despite rubbing shoulders with some of the biggest names in showbusiness, Parkinson has been with his beloved wife Mary for almost six decades.
He praised his other half’s support during his health struggles in recent years, including a prostate cancer diagnosis in 2013.
He said: “Mary has been wonderful all the way through.
